Course Details
• Robotics Safety Fundamentals: An introduction to the basic principles of robotics safety, including potential hazards, risk assessment, and safety standards.
• Space Robotics Environment: Understanding the unique challenges and risks associated with space robotics, such as microgravity, extreme temperatures, and radiation.
• Robotics Safety Protocols: Detailed examination of safety protocols for robotics in various applications, including design, operation, and maintenance.
• Space Robotics Safety Standards: Overview of the international safety standards and guidelines for space robotics, including ISO and NASA standards.
• Human-Robot Interaction Safety: Analysis of the safety considerations for human-robot interaction, including communication, collaboration, and emergency procedures.
• Robotics Safety Training: Best practices for training personnel in robotics safety, including hazard recognition, safe work practices, and emergency response.
• Robotics Safety Inspections: Procedures for conducting regular safety inspections of robotics systems, including documentation, reporting, and follow-up actions.
• Robotics Accident Investigation: Techniques for investigating robotics accidents and incidents, including root cause analysis and corrective action planning.
